Dr Stefan Fafinski, director of Invenio Research, has been appointed a Visiting Fellow of the Oxford Internet Institute in the University of Oxford. At the OII, Stefan is continuing his work into mapping and measuring cybercrime, the criminogenic potential of existing and emergent Internet technologies, their social impact and the policy implications for their regulation.

‘Scareware’ scam affects 40 million users

Monday, October 19th, 2009

 

Online criminals are making millions of pounds by convincing computer users to download fake anti-virus software, claim Symantec.


Their research shows that more than 40 million people have fallen victim to the “scareware” scam in the past 12 months.


The download is usually harmful and criminals can sometimes use it to get the victim’s credit card details. Symantec has identified 250 versions of scareware, and criminals are thought to earn more than £750,000 each a year.
